the edgware sephardi community trust

The charity supports people of a particular ethnic or racial origin. The Edgware Sephardi Community Trust is a registered charity whose purpose is religious activities. It delivers its work by providing services. The charity is based in Middlesex and operates in Barnet.

Activities & Mission

TO FOUND AND MAINTAIN A SYNAGOGUE WITHIN EDGWARE, MIDDLESEX TO CONFORM WITH THE PRACTICES OF THE SEPHARDI ORTHODOX COMMUNITY OF THE JEWISH RELIGION TOGETHER WITH THE ADVANCEMENT OF THE EDUCATION OF CHILDREN AND YOUNG PERSONS OF THE JEWISH FAITH IN THE LOCAL COMMUNITY OF EDGWARE, MIDDLESEX
